Hallo Leute. Gibts ne Möglichkeit, in einem Skript den Rechner vom 3. in den 1. Runlevel zu fahren, und dann - nach Übergabe des Root-Paßwortes - im Skript fortzufahren? Andy
* Andy Feile schrieb am 26.Feb.2002:
Gibts ne Möglichkeit, in einem Skript den Rechner vom 3. in den 1. Runlevel zu fahren,
Kein Problem. Einfach ein init 1 macht das. Also root natürlich.
und dann - nach Übergabe des Root-Paßwortes - im Skript fortzufahren?
Das willst Du nicht wirklich. Allerdings, wenn Du das skript mit nohup startest müßte es eigentlich den Runlevelwechsel überleben, da nur die Prozesse gekillt werden, die von init gestartet wurden. Allerdings ist auch die Loginshell dabei und die versendet ein SIGHUP an alle Prozesse, die von ihr gestartet wurde. Dieses Signal müßte nur aufgefangen werden. Also entweder ein trap 1 oder ein nohup. ein Versuch wäre es Wert. Bernd -- LILO funktioniert nicht? Hast Du /etc/lilo.conf verändert und vergessen, lilo aufzurufen? Ist Deine /boot-Partition unter der 1024 Zylindergrenze? Bei anderen LILO Problemen mal in der SDB nachschauen: http://localhost/doc/sdb/de/html/rb_bootdisk.html |Zufallssignatur 6
participants (2)
-
Andy Feile
-
B.Brodesser@t-online.de